
Community Experience Producer
Demand.io, Los Angeles, CA, United States
$22M revenue. Profitable. Bootstrapped. 20 people doing what competitors need 200 for.
Every AI assistant is trained to close the deal—to be the realtor. We built the home inspector. Product.ai tells you what NOT to buy, and we're the only ones who can. Now we need someone to bring that same rigor to how we show up in the world.
We are
Product.ai (currently operating as Demand.io) —the company building the verification layer for AI commerce. You may know us through
SimplyCodes—the leading AI-powered savings tool driving $1B+ in annual commerce . In early 2026, we complete our transformation and formally become Product.ai.
What we’re building:
Product.ai is a recommendation engine that doesn’t guess—it verifies. We ingest product data, marketing claims, and real user feedback, then use adversarial AI to expose hidden flaws and surface the products that actually deliver. Think "Consumer Reports meets ChatGPT"—but with receipts.
Why we’re different:
Perplexity summarizes the web—including the lies. ChatGPT is trained to be agreeable—it hedges. Google ranks by ads. We pre-verify claims through adversarial pressure testing and deliver the confident "No" that no other AI can. (Read the thesis)
We are seeking a
Community Experience Producer
to own the operational execution of every external-facing experience we create. This is not an office manager role—you will be the execution engine that translates creative vision into flawless reality for Vanguard (our invite-only community), HQ activations, and high-stakes rituals.
Why this role is different:
Most community roles are about content calendars and engagement metrics. This one is about physical production—events that people remember, spaces that signal excellence, experiences that make people want to come back. We treat our Santa Monica HQ as a theater, not an office. You’re the stage manager.
What You Will Build
The Event Production Engine:
Own end-to-end execution of Vanguard events—from kickoff brief to post-mortem. Registration flows, venue logistics, vendor negotiations, run‑of‑show, and the "Oh Sh*t" contingencies that separate amateurs from professionals.
The Threshold Experience:
Master the first 90 seconds. When 150 people arrive for a Salon, you own the registration flow, building coordination, security protocols, and the invisible choreography that signals "you’re in the right place" before anyone says a word.
The Community Infrastructure:
Build the operational layer of our Vanguard community—member onboarding, milestone fulfillment, engagement tracking. When a member earns recognition, you ensure the physical reward ships within 48 hours.
The Show-Ready Standard:
Treat our Santa Monica HQ as a theater, not an office. The "set" is always dressed for unannounced visitors. Candidate experiences, board dinners, investor visits—the environment signals excellence before anyone walks through the door.
Who You Are We do not care about your pedigree; we care about your mechanics.
You are an operator first.
You have a bias toward action under pressure. You fix the broken chair before the guest arrives—you don’t file a ticket about it. When the caterer cancels 3 hours before doors, you solve it. You don’t elevate it.
You are a systems thinker second.
You hate solving the same problem twice. After chaotic registration at one event, you build "Registration Protocol v1.0" so it never happens again. You leave documentation in your wake.
You have experiential production in your bones.
3‑5 years executing brand activations, experiential marketing, or hospitality. You know vendor negotiation, building security coordination, room‑reading, and the thousand invisible decisions that separate a forgettable event from a memorable one.
You read rooms.
High emotional intelligence. You know when to step in, when to fade, when the energy needs a redirect. You manage up, down, and sideways without creating friction.
You thrive in ambiguity.
You don’t freeze when the plan changes. You’re comfortable with last‑minute pivots and incomplete information.
You multiply with tools.
You use AI for vendor briefs, Notion for playbooks, Airtable for inventory tracking. You’re not building agents—you're leveraging existing tools to 10x your output.
Compensation & Ownership We operate as a high‑performance studio, not a typical corporation. We share the upside directly with our builders via direct ownership.
Elite Base Salary:
$95,000 – $130,000 . Competitive with LA experiential production market. Your base covers your life; your equity builds your freedom.
Profits Interest Units (PIUs):
You will receive a formal equity stake via
Class B Membership Interests . Unlike Stock Options, PIUs have a
$0 strike price , participate in the upside from day one, and qualify for
Capital Gains tax treatment , maximizing your long‑term wealth.
Ongoing Profit Distribution:
As an equity holder, you participate in our annual success. You are entitled to a pro‑rata share of our
Free Cash Flow (FCF) —receiving your portion of the company’s profit as an annual dividend.
Annual Liquidity:
We do not believe in "Paper Wealth." We operate an
Annual Tender Offer
where the company buys back vested interests. You have the option to turn your ownership into cash every year—you don’t have to wait for an exit.
Benefits:
100% premium coverage for you and your family, daily catered lunches, and unlimited PTO that we actually expect you to use to recharge.
Growth Path:
Year 1: Master the event engine. Year 2: Own community operations end‑to‑end, hire an Events Coordinator. Year 3: Director of Community Experience with a team of 2‑3.
